Junior Big Leaguers (1950s)

Creator: A/V Geeks 16mm Films

Description: In a suburban Bronxville community, two rival youth baseball teams, the Cyclones and the Tornadoes, face off in a game. The Cyclones struggle throughout the match, trailing significantly until they seek help from a retired Major League player to improve their skills. After a training session focusing on teamwork and fundamentals, the Cyclones enter a championship game against the Tornadoes. In a thrilling final inning, the Cyclones rally together, scoring three runs to win the game 22-21, becoming the new champions of Bronxville. Cyclones lose the ball game just another in a long series of defeats what this team needs is to master the fundamentals of the game and it may be that the catcher has the solution to the problem he lives near a former retired Major League player the catcher is sure they can get some valuable pointers from him they all go over to see him once there a,1 questions pop in the minds of the young players or here is a chance to improve their game after all this major leager has played with all the famous Professionals of the game the retired ball player listens to the history of the Cyclones but not to all nine of the players talking at once the captain of the team speaks for all and makes arrangements with the Oldtimer for a training session the following afternoon from their new trainer the Cyclones learn that the defensive game is based on the close coordination of the seven fielders without such the work of the pitcher which consists in detaining the opposing batter before he can reach first base is made more difficult the pitcher and catcher form what is called the battery and here again coordination must be perfect for example the pitcher should at all times maintain proper position prior to throwing the ball so his opponent on first base won't be able to anticipate the throw and steal second base proper placement and con Conant watchfulness immobilize the opposing player on first base this in turn helps the catcher prevent opposing players from stealing bases the catcher can also help the pitcher with signals and by offering a good Target for the pitched ball without the closest cooperation between pitcher and catcher not even a major league team could hope to win ball games first base is defended by the first baseman who is one of the four infielders a top-notch first baseman must specialize in catching all kinds of throws from the players protecting the other bases and in order to do this he must be able to quickly assume positions to the right and left of first base since not all throws are perfect at second base the short stop and the second baseman have roughly the same responsibilities these two players are told what a double play consists of they were always surprised when such plays didn't pan out well and now they know the reason why in other words a well thrown and quickly thrown ball enables the second player to make the play to First in plenty of time here the two boys are playing like professionals putting one Runner out between first and second as well as putting out the hitter at first Third Base like first is defended by a baseman the big problem of the third baseman is coping with grounders NE must learn to use both hands in making catches an alert third baseman can nearly always anticipate a butt by employing the right technique he can throw his opponent out and finally we have the outfielders one in left field one in center field and one in right field these are positions of great responsibility they must learn the proper way in which to handle fly balls making a quick throw to whatever base runners are advancing upon a baseman goes for the ball as soon as the batter hits it and tries to get it to First in time to make the put out so we come to the championship game of the school seated there in the bleachers are the families of the various players belonging to the two teams the Cyclones and
